The regimen is as stated; you use NO shampoo to cleanse your hair. It's a moisture based regimen. You wash your hair with conditioner, some also use apple cider vinegar to cleanse and help with dandruff and dry scalp. WEN cleansing system is based on the no shampoo regimen and Sally's now has a version of WEN, called Hair One.
